Welcome to the official Australian Open TV RU-vid channel. The Australian Open is the first Grand Slam of the year and takes place in Melbourne. Rafael Nadal is the men’s singles reigning champion and Ashleigh Barty is the women’s singles reigning champion. The tournament takes place on 25 hard courts, including Rod Laver Arena, Margaret Court Arena and John Cain Arena. Look out for highlights, press conferences, memorable moments and much more!

Rybakina implemented the correct tactics against Ostapenko; which everyone should implement. That is by hitting a good amount of balls outside the middle of the court. Ostapenko's whole game is dictating the point from the middle of the court going for the corners. She can't play any other way because of her lack of fitness and weight. The only thing Rybakina lacked is the FH down-the-line shot. She needs to work on that shot big-time. Then she'll have a nearly complete package. She really likes to flatten out her FH going cross-court and wants to do that all day long but at some point her opponents are going to cheat to the deuce side knowing she can't pull the trigger down the line.
